🏛️

History

The pigment verdigris — a green formed by the corrosion of copper — was widely used in medieval manuscripts and early oil painting, despite its tendency to darken over time.

Color Categories

Color formats

Name
When Vintage Brook through Laboring
HEX
#5b9423
RGB
rgb(91,148,35)
RGB%
rgb(35.7%,58%,13.7%)
HSL
hsl(90,62%,36%)
HSV
hsv(90,76%,58%)
CMYK
cmyk(39,0,76,42)
LAB
lab(56,-37,50)
LCH
lch(56,62,127)
sRGB
(0.357,0.58,0.137)
HEX8
#5b9423ff
